Output 577a614b32c759329508facd697c6fc62cabf831bacd8a3532ec56c2c69aa05b:1

value
5446876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d62d0ebd5c3c9ee40d1269f00159bfeb838fc4 OP_EQUAL
address
AD7fwxEqyoegjt5yB3wWqd2oBrxHbxq4WN
transaction
577a614b32c759329508facd697c6fc62cabf831bacd8a3532ec56c2c69aa05b